foldrr's weblog

旧ブログ http://d.hatena.ne.jp/foldrr/

CORESERVER で svn+ssh 接続する

coreserver では複数ユーザでの Subversion 運用はできないので注意。

リポジトリの作成

mkdir repo
cd repo
svnadmin create repo1

鍵の作成

  • http://d.hatena.ne.jp/re_guzy/20071001/p1
  • putty をダウンロード。
  • puttygen を起動。
  • 以下 puttygen で操作。
    • "Generate" ボタンをクリック。
    • マウスを動かして鍵を生成。
    • "Public key for ..." の中身をコピーする。
    • コピーした内容を authrized_keys として保存する。
    • "Save private key" をクリック。
    • 秘密鍵を *.ppk として保存する。
    • 以下 ftp で操作。
cd ~
chmod 700 .ssh
cd .ssh
chmod 600 authorized_keys

TortoiseSVN を設定

TortoiseSVN でチェックアウト

  • フォルダを作成する。
  • フォルダを右クリックしてチェックアウト。
  • 何度かパスワードを聞かれるので入力。

TortoiseSVN でコミット

  • 右クリックしてコミット。
  • パスワードを聞かれるので入力。